An Executive Certificate in Public Finance Communication equips professionals with the crucial skills to effectively communicate complex financial information to diverse audiences. This specialized program focuses on crafting compelling narratives around public budgets, financial policies, and government spending.
Learning outcomes include mastering techniques for clear and concise financial writing, developing persuasive presentations for stakeholders, and utilizing data visualization to enhance communication impact. Graduates will also understand the nuances of public sector communication, including media relations and crisis communication in the context of public finance.
The program duration typically ranges from a few weeks to several months, depending on the institution and the intensity of the coursework. The flexible format often caters to working professionals, allowing them to balance their careers with professional development. Many programs offer online or hybrid options for added convenience.
This certificate holds significant industry relevance for professionals working in government, non-profit organizations, and public finance firms. It enhances career prospects for budget analysts, financial managers, public relations specialists, and anyone needing to effectively communicate financial information within the public sector. The skills learned are transferable to various roles requiring strong communication and financial literacy skills, improving job performance and leadership potential.
Individuals pursuing careers in governmental accounting, financial reporting, or public policy will find the Executive Certificate in Public Finance Communication invaluable. The program fosters expertise in advocacy, stakeholder engagement, and strategic communication—all essential elements for success in public finance roles.
